3. What RiskSQOR does not do

For the avoidance of doubt, RiskSQOR does not: submit, prepare or advise on CQC registration applications; write policies or procedures on the Club’s behalf; provide medical cover, clinical services or medical advice; or guarantee CQC registration, league compliance, insurance outcomes or any regulatory result. An assessment is an independent, evidence-based review at a point in time. It is not legal, medical or regulatory advice, and a score is not a warranty that no incident will occur. Responsibility for the Club’s medical provision remains at all times with the Club.

7. Confidentiality and use of results

The Club’s score, report and evidence are confidential to the Club. RiskSQOR will not publish or disclose them without the Club’s written consent. The Club may share its report internally and with its board, league, insurer, broker or regulator. Anonymised results are used for research and benchmarking only where the Club has signed the separate Research Participation Consent Form; declining research participation does not affect the Services or price. Case studies are published only with the assessed organisation’s written permission.

11. Liability

Nothing in this Agreement excludes or limits liability for death or personal injury caused by negligence, for fraud or fraudulent misrepresentation, or for anything else that cannot be excluded under the law of England and Wales. Subject to that, RiskSQOR’s total aggregate liability arising out of or in connection with an assessment year is limited to the fees paid by the Club for that assessment year, and RiskSQOR is not liable for loss of profit, loss of opportunity, or indirect or consequential loss, or for decisions taken or not taken by the Club, a regulator, league, broker or insurer in reliance on a score or report.
